With partner and fellow lifelong horse racing enthusiast Bill Joyce, Barr established the Hampshire Alliance syndicate in 1988. Tbgether, they created a way to share costs, risks and winnings among partnerships formed for horse ownership.

Tve always love horses and horse racing,” said English native Barr, now 70 and living in Front Royal. “But there was just no way I could afford to get into it as a private owner.
